    Intended Use
    The non-absorbable suture anchors are intended to reattach soft tissue to bone in orthopedic surgical procedures. The CONMED Argo Knotless® Anchor may be used in either arthroscopic or open surgical procedures. After the suture is anchored to the bone, it may be used to reattach soft tissue, such as ligaments, tendons, or joint capsules to the bone. The suture anchor system thereby stabilizes the damaged tissue, in conjunction with appropriate postoperative immobilization throughout the healing period.
    Device Description
    The CONMED Argo Knotless® Anchor is an implantable bone anchor, that is supplied single use, sterilized via ethylene oxide (ETO) to a SAL of 10⁻⁶. The threaded anchor and the suture eyelet are manufactured of PolyEtherEtherKetone (PEEK) material. Each size features a single use driver, a threaded anchor, suture eyelet, a 1.0mm UHMWPE Hi-Fi™, non-absorbable retention suture, and loader tab. The retention suture holds the PEEK eyelet in place on the driver and can be incorporated into the repair if desired. A maximum of six (6) Hi-Fi #2 suture, or 1.3mm Hi-Fi ribbon suture, or (2) two limbs of Hi-Fi tape, or one (1) bioresorbable reinforced implant can be threaded through the eyelet. The repair sutures are then tensioned and cleated on the driver cleat, if deemed necessary by the surgeon. These anchor configurations require a pre-prepared bone hole which can be created with Class I, Exempt instrumentation.

    Intended Use
    The BioBrace® RC Delivery System is intended for use in rotator cuff surgical procedures for reinforcement of soft tissue where weakness exists. The BioBrace® Implant is intended for reinforcement of soft tissues that are repaired by suture or suture anchors, during rotator cuff tendon repair surgery. The BioBrace® Implant is not intended to replace normal body structures or provide the full mechanical strength to support the rotator cuff. Sutures used to repair the tear, and sutures or bone anchors used to attach the tissue to bone, provide mechanical strength for the tendon repair. The Disposable Inserter is intended to facilitate the delivery and positioning of the implant during soft tissue repairs.
    Device Description
    The BioBrace® RC Delivery System is comprised of a BioBrace® Implant pre-stitched with HI-FI® suture, a threader assembly that facilitates passing sutures through the BioBrace® Implant, and an inserter to facilitate placement of the BioBrace® Implant into the subacromial space. The previously cleared BioBrace® Implant is a bioresorbable, reinforced Implant composed of a highly porous collagen sponge made from insoluble bovine tendon type-1 collagen and reinforced with poly-L-lactic-acid (PLLA) multifilament yarn. The BioBrace® Implant is 80% porous with a median pore diameter of 19 µm. BioBrace® implants are approximately 3 mm thick and provided in two rectangular sizes of 23 x 25 mm and 35 x 25 mm. The BioBrace® RC Delivery System is single-use and supplied sterile (ETO).

    Intended Use
    BioBrace® is intended for use in surgical procedures for reinforcement of soft tissue where weakness exists. BioBrace® is also intended for reinforcement of soft tissues that are repaired by suture or other fixation devices during tendon and ligament repair surgery including reinforcement of rotator cuff, patellar, Achilles, biceps, quadriceps tendon, medial collateral ligament, lateral collateral ligament, spring ligament, deltoid ligament, ulnar collateral ligament or other tendons or extraarticular ligaments. BioBrace® is not intended to replace normal body structure or provide the full mechanical strength to support the rotator cuff, patellar, Achilles, biceps, quadriceps tendon, medial collateral ligament, lateral collateral ligament, soring ligament, deltoid ligament, ulnar collateral ligament or other tendons or extra-articular ligaments. Sutures, used to repair the tear, and sutures or other fixation devices, used to attach the tissue to the bone, provide mechanical strength for the repair.
    Device Description
    The BioBrace® implant is a bioresorbable and bioinductive scaffold composed of a highly-porous collagen sponge made from insoluble bovine tendon type-1 collagen, and reinforced with poly- L-lactic-acid (PLLA) multifilament yarn (75 denier, 15 micron filament diameter). The BioBrace implant is 80% porous, average density of 0.2 grams/cm3, and median pore diameter of 19 microns. The highly porous collagen sponge comprises the majority of implant surface area (0.7 m2/gram) versus the PLA filaments alone (0.2 m2/gram), creating a large biologic matrix for cellular ingrowth, tissue regeneration, and healing. BioBrace implants are approximately 3 mm thick, provided in multiple sizes, and provide for soft tissue and tendon augment, and clinically relevant strengthening of the surgical repair. The BioBrace implant is single-use and supplied sterile with SAL of 10-6.

    Intended Use
    The CONMED PlumeSafe® X5™ Smoke Management System is designed to remove and filter smoke and aerosols from a surgical site produced during electrosurgical and laser procedures.
    Device Description
    The PlumeSafe® X5™ Smoke Management System is a portable, stand-alone, capital unit, that when paired with a reusable filter and disposable accessories makes up a Smoke Management System. The smoke unit is accompanied by a reusable filter and is available in two different configurations, a 22mm or 25mm size. Each filter is designed to capture components of surgical smoke and return clean air to the environment and can connect to different accessories which include pencils, adapters, fluid traps, and tube sets. Each filter is a seff-contained device that is completely enclosed to protect health care personnels from potential contamination during filter changes. Each filter is comprised of filtration (gross particulate pre-filter, Ultra-Low Penetration Air (ULPA), coconutbased carbon, impregnated alumina, and carbon dust capture media) that produce capture efficiency ratings equal to or better than 99.999% for particles ranging in size from 0.01μm to 0.2μm. PlumeSafe® X5™ is comprised of a vacuum motor, aluminum, steel, and plastic components combined with sound reducing insulation. The vacuum motor is used to draw the surgical site, through an accessory, and into the PlumeSafe® X5™ filter. The PlumeSafe® X5™ Smoke Management System provides multiple modes (open, laparoscopic, and pencil) and settings to adjust the flow to the clinical need.

    Intended Use
    CONMED CleanSeal Vessel Sealers are intended to be used in open and mimimally invasive procedures for the ligation and division of tissue bundles, lymphatics, and vessels up to and including 6 mm vessels (arteries, veins, pulmonary arteries, pulmonary veins). The handpiece is indicated for use in gynecological and general surgical procedures, including urologic, thoracic, and vascular. These procedures include, but are not limited to, hysterectomies, colectomies, Nissen fundoplication, and adhesiolysis. CleanSeal vessel sealer has not been shown to be effective for ubal sterilization or tubal coagulation for sterilization procedures. Do not use CleanSeal vessel sealer for these procedures.
    Device Description
    CleanSeal Advanced Bipolar Vessel Sealer Maryland is designed to be used, with a compatible MEP-1 electrosurqical generator, in open and minimally invasive procedures for the ligation and division of tissue bundles, lymphatics, and vessels up to and including 6 mm arteries and veins. They are sterile, single use bipolar vessel sealing hand pieces featuring double action non-stick coated jaws, three shaft length options, a one-hand controlled handle with latchable lever. The instrument creates a seal by application of radio frequency (RF) electrosurgical energy to vascular structures or tissue bundles interposed between the jaws.

    Device Description
    The ConMed AirSeal iFS System consists of the following major components: (1) a trocar, (2) a cannula, (3) tube sets, and (4) a microprocessor-controlled insufflation, recirculation and filtration unit. The cannula, trocar and tube sets are sterile, single-use products. The AirSeal iFS System is an active medical device, nonsterile and reusable and is intended to insufflate a body cavity. The AirSeal iFS System is designed to function in one of three (3) separate modes of operation: (a) Insufflation Mode; (b) AirSeal Mode (Adult and Pediatric); or (c) Smoke Evacuation Mode. The ConMed AirSeal dV Solution (or AirSeal Robotic Solution) consists of the following major components: (1) AirSeal® Cannula Cap with a cannula cap and an obturator (in standard and long lengths), and (2) AirSeal® Bifurcated Filtered Tube Set. The cannula cap, obturator and tube set are sterile, single-use products. The AirSeal dV Solution, in conjunction with Intuitive daVinci XiX Cannula and Cannula Seal, is operated in the Airseal Mode with the AirSeal iFS System to distend a cavity by filling it with gas, to create and maintain a gas-sealed obstruction-free path of entry for endoscopic instruments, and to evacuate surgical smoke. The ConMed AirSeal dV Solution is a sterile, single use device, primarily composed of polycarbonate, and stainless steel.
